How this is worked out

  1. Take both airports' published coordinates from OurAirports — nothing here is scraped from another flight site.
  2. Great-circle distance by haversine on a mean earth radius of 6,371.0088 km: 18,493 km.
  3. Airborne time = that distance ÷ 805 km/h, a representative jet cruise speed: 22h 58m.
  4. Add a flat 25 minutes for pushback, taxi, climb, descent and taxi-in — the reason a 400 km hop is never half an hour: 23h 24m gate to gate.
  5. Winds, aircraft type and airline schedule padding are not modelled. The cruise-speed table shows how much that assumption is worth.
18,493 km / 805 km/h = 22h 58m airborne
            + 25 min ground = 23h 24m gate to gate

Flight time at different cruise speeds

Aircraft type, winds and routing all move the real number. This is the same distance flown at different speeds, plus the 25-minute ground and climb allowance.

Typical ofCruise speedAirborneGate to gate
Turboprop / regional550 km/h33h 37m34h 03m
Narrowbody jet (A320, 737)780 km/h23h 43m24h 08m
Widebody jet (777, 787, A350)900 km/h20h 33m20h 58m
Private jet (Gulfstream)850 km/h21h 45m22h 11m

Headwinds on an eastbound long-haul routinely add 30–60 minutes; the same route westbound can be quicker. Airlines publish schedules with padding built in.

How far is Narita from São Paulo?

18,493 kilometres in a straight line over the earth's surface — 11,491 miles or 9,985 nautical miles. Actual flown distance is usually 2–5% longer because aircraft follow airways, avoid weather and route around restricted airspace.

Is there a non-stop flight between NRT and GRU?

This page calculates the direct-line time and distance; it does not track airline schedules. At 18,493 km the route is at the extreme end of what any airliner can fly non-stop, so a connection is likely. Check an airline or booking site for what is actually scheduled.
